What Occurs If Fees Are Gone Down?

Some costs might be dropped within days of apprehension if clear proof issues exist, while others might take months of critical lawful work prior to prosecutors consent to termination. If the fees are "dismissed with bias" the situation is disregarded completely. If the charges are "dismissed without prejudice" the prosecutor may have the ability to refile the costs, at least till the law of limitations goes out. Regulations on this differ relying on the seriousness of the charges and the jurisdiction. " Nolle prosequi" is an official declaration that the district attorney abandons the fees, while dismissal is a court order ending the case. Both efficiently finish prosecution, yet dismissal usually calls for judicial approval while nolle prosequi is a prosecutorial decision. Either end result accomplishes our objective of getting charges dropped before your court date.
